The next day passed quickly, with Ivy at work and Maggie at school. Ivy stopped at the grocery store on the way home, buying a gallon of milk, peanut butter, jelly, block cheese, and bread. When she arrived home, she brought the supplies inside and then ate dinner with Maggie. Over dinner, Ivy went over what all Maggie would need to do each day, insisting on making a list that Maggie could check off each day. After making sure her sister had the information drilled into her head, Ivy turned to packing her suitcase. She made sure to pack light, bringing only a couple change of clothes, toothbrush and toothpaste, charging cord for her phone, and snacks. Making sure everything was in place and waiting where she would see it in the morning, Ivy went to bed early, knowing she would need her sleep. She said goodnight to Maggie and slipped under the welcoming covers.

At approximately five o'clock in the morning, Ivy awoke to an irritating buzzing from her alarm on her phone. Moaning into her pillow, Ivy lifted her head up silenced the alarm, refraining from sinking back into her pillow. Throwing back her blankets, Ivy swung her legs over the side of the bed. She yawned, and absently rubbed her arm. Standing up, Ivy grabbed her suitcase from where she had packed it the night before and moved it to by the garage door. Reluctantly, Ivy changed out of her pajamas into lounge pants and a T-shirt, telling herself that she would change into dress pants and shirt when she arrived. Going into the bathroom, Ivy brushed her teeth and put her hair up in a messy bun. After she had double-checked her suitcase, assuring herself that she had everything, she went into Maggie's room. Sitting on her bed, Ivy started rubbing her younger sister's back. Maggie inhaled deeply and cracked an eye open.

"Good-bye." Ivy smiled.

"Bye." Maggie gave a tired smile back.

"Do you have an alarm set for school?"

"Ye-es." Maggie confirmed.

"If anyone calls for me, just say I'm not available." Ivy instructed, "And don't forget to lock the doors."

"I'll be fine, worrywart." Maggie laughed.

"I should be back late tomorrow night. At the latest day after tomorrow." Ivy kissed the top of Maggie's head, "Love you, sis."

"Love you too." Maggie smiled.

Ivy stood up from the bed and left the room, leaving the door cracked. Grabbing her suitcase, Ivy opened the garage door and climbed into the car, putting the suitcase in the backseat. Pulling out of the garage, she closed the big door behind herself. Pulling out her phone, she typed in the directions Jake had given her to the conference. Following the directions, Ivy began driving to her destination.

After multiple stops at McDonalds for coffee, Ivy arrived at the conference, She had forgone a hotel for the present, deciding to wait and see until after the conference. Five minutes before she had reached the conference, she had taken one last stop at McDonalds, and going into the restrooms, had changed into her dress clothes. Pulling into the closest parking spot she could find, Ivy stopped the car and got out, bringing only her phone with her. She walked quickly to the building. Entering through the doors, Ivy asked for directions, and then went to the room being used for the conference. Opening the doors as quietly as she could, Ivy snuck into the room. Her first impression was of size. The room was huge, and filled with people. Desperately, Ivy searched for a seat, finding one near the back.

Ivy had been sitting at a conference, waiting for it to start, when a tall young man with dark hair sat down next to her. After a few minutes he got back up, but Ivy noticed he had left a small, leather notebook and a small dark brown bottle on his seat. She looked at them curiously.

Did he leave them purposely for me? She wondered. Coming to a decision, she reached over with trembling hands and picked the notebook up. Untying the string that held the book closed, she opened it. The first twenty or so pages were maps, charts, and drawings. Ivy skimmed through these until she came to a page of writing.

Leventar 72, 4601

It is the first day of my stay on this planet. But already I know my stay will be short. There isn't enough Starbeam on this planet they call earth. I can sense this in the air. It is unclean and hard to breathe in.

I have collected as much as I could today. But tomorrow I believe I know where I can find more.

Wide-eyed and confused, Ivy flipped the page and continued reading.

Leventar 73, 4601

The day has gone well. The Starbeam has been collected successfully. Thankfully, the common people of earth do not know of the existence of Starbeam, and thus the government cannot announce that it is missing, and thus cannot take large measures to get it back. My mission is almost complete. I just need one more day.

Then the pages were blank. Ivy stared at the blank pages, realizing what that meant. Today was the last day.

She saw movement in front of her, and jerked her head up. In front of her was the dark-haired young man. His face seemed to shimmer, and for a moment Ivy thought she saw a tint of dark blue showing through. He was smiling at her, but that did not comfort Ivy.

"I see you've read my notebook."
